Abstract
In accordance with an embodiment, a circuit includes an oscillator having an oscillation frequency dependent on an input signal, a digital accumulator having a first input coupled to an output of the oscillator, a digital-to-analog converter (DAC) coupled to an output of the digital accumulator, an analog loop filter coupled to an output of the digital-to-analog converter, and a comparison circuit having an input coupled to an output of the analog loop filter and an output coupled to a second input of the digital accumulator.
